the claim
Drug withdrawal can be fatal and requires continued consumption
the verdict
CONTESTED
the evidence cuts both ways
confidence 34/100

While certain drug withdrawals like alcohol or barbiturates can indeed be medically dangerous or fatal if unmanaged, they are treated with supervised medical tapering and evidence-based pharmacotherapy rather than requiring continued consumption of the substance.

Evidence for · 2
The drug management of severe alcohol withdrawal syndrome
1990 · cited by 9
Paper [0] discusses severe alcohol withdrawal syndromes such as delirium tremens, which can be life-threatening and require intensive clinical management.
Evidence against · 2
The Buprenorphine Paradox: How Buprenorphine Triggers and Resolves Opioid Withdrawal.
2026 · cited by 0
Paper [5] details how partial agonists like buprenorphine resolve opioid withdrawal rather than requiring continued consumption of full agonist drugs of abuse.
